Dioxin
Dioxin is one of many chemicals that has been linked to various kinds of cancers. It is harmful to kidneys, liver and central nervous system.
It is found in water, soil and air. It can also be absorbed via the skin or eaten by eating. It is a member of the so-called "dirty dozen" chemicals.
People who are exposed at dioxins at high levels through industrial accidents or exposure to work could be afflicted with health issues, including cancer, liver problems and thyroid disease. However, the health risks of dioxins in low concentrations aren't well-known.
Researchers are still studying the long-term consequences of the contamination. It has been linked to cancer in laboratory animals as well as people who live near contaminated areas.
According to the World Health Organization (WHO) Dioxins have been shown to increase the risk for certain kinds of cancer. They can also harm the immune system and reproductive systems. They can also cause birth defects.
The most popular ways that dioxins are absorption occurs through eating fats, burning household waste and being exposed to hazardous waste. Other sources of dioxins found in the environment include industrial accidents, herbicides and pesticides.

Toxic Metals
Metals such as cadmium, copper, nickel, mercury, chromium and iron are vital to our lives however they can become toxic if used in excess. They can also be found in tiny amounts in sewage, and other polluting sources, as well in electronic waste (ewaste).
Many heavy metals in the environment are linked to various diseases including cancer. Despite their significance in the development and onset of these diseases, it is still not evident how they affect various organ systems or how to avoid their toxicity.
The chemical properties of ions as well as the specific targets cellular ions they interact with to determine the toxicity of heavy metals. These interactions include the formation of ROS, inhibition of enzymes that make oxygen-producing metabolites and the inactivation other proteins that have the potential to protect cells against toxicity.
Each metal is distinct in its toxicity. Cadmium and copper for instance, may weaken antioxidant defenses through the generation of superoxide anionradios (ROS) that damage mitochondrial and DNA functions.
